What is the distinction in between a dental practitioner and an orthodontist? To address an inquiry that is often asked, both dental practitioners and orthodontists assist patients get better oral health, albeit in various methods. It aids to keep in mind that dentistry is a rather wide science with different clinical expertises. All dentists, including orthodontists, treat the teeth, gum tissues, jaw and nerves.


Orthodontists and dentists both give oral look after people. Orthodontists can operate in a dental workplace and offer the very same therapies as other dentists. You can believe of both doctors that deal with gum tissue and teeth problems. The major distinction is that ending up being an orthodontist calls for a certain specialty in dealing with the misalignment of the teeth and jaw.

An orthodontist is a dentist that has undertaken training to specialize in the medical diagnosis, prevention and therapy of irregularities in the jaw and teeth. They can additionally recognize potential problems in teeth alignment that might create when conditions are left without treatment (best orthodontist near me).


This includes all the necessary education and learning to become a general dental practitioner. According to the American Pupil Dental Organization (ASDA), it suggests you will certainly require to have either a Doctor of Medicine in Dental Care (DMD) or a Physician of Oral Surgery (DDS). In other words, orthodontists require to finish oral college and afterwards acquire an orthodontics specialty education and learning.


Some orthodontists additionally get their masters in craniofacial biology. These programs focus on 2 particular locations or self-controls: Dentofacial Orthopedics: This study focuses on directing teeth and jaw advancement.

Malocclusion, or misaligned teeth, can result in dental issues, including tooth degeneration, gum tissue illness, and difficult or painful eating. Not everybody is birthed with straight teeth. If you have a negative bite or large spaces in between your teeth, you may desire to get in touch with a dentist focusing on orthodontic treatment.


(Picture Debt: DigitalVision/Getty Images) Orthodontists utilize repaired and detachable oral devices, like braces, retainers, and bands, to alter the position of teeth in your mouth. Orthodontic treatment is for oral problems, consisting of: Jagged teethBite troubles, like an overbite or an underbiteCrowded teeth or teeth that are as well far apartJaw misalignmentThe goal of orthodontic therapy is to improve your bite.

A healthy and balanced bite guarantees you can eat, eat, and talk effectively. While you may think about orthodontists as mainly for children or teenagers who need braces, they can deal with dental problems at any age. Orthodontists go to university, dental college, and orthodontic institution. After college graduation, they spend 2 or 3 years in an orthodontic residency program.


All orthodontists are dentists, but not all dental practitioners are orthodontists. Orthodontic residency programs offer intensive, focused direction for dental specialists. They focus on two locations: How to appropriately and safely relocate teeth Exactly how to properly guide development in the teeth, jaw, and faceOnce an orthodontist has actually finished training, they have the choice to come to be board accredited.


Malocclusion leads to tooth congestion, a twisted jaw, or uneven bite patterns. Malocclusion is generally treated with: Your orthodontist affixes metal, ceramic, or plastic square bonds to your teeth.

If you have just small malocclusion, you may have the ability to make use of clear dental braces, called aligners, rather than standard braces. Some people require a headgear to help move teeth right into line with pressure from outside the mouth. After braces or aligners, you'll need to wear a retainer. A retainer is a custom-made tool that maintains your teeth in position.
